    Random BSOD 0x124 occurences


    Hello, I've been plagued by a BSOD issue for quite a while already and ultimately I have failed to fix it by myself so I would like to ask for some help.

    As a sort of user-gathered information its probably important for me to mention the following things:

    1) the BSOD always gives the same 0x124 error;
    2) it started right after i bought the new graphic card in november;
    2.1) despite it might seem obvious that it could be caused by a faulty graphic card I've ran a few tests using Furmark, OCCT and some other software to check it and during those tests i havent gotten any bsod;
    3) I have reinstalled windows recently as an attempt to fix bsod as well;
    4) BSOD often occurs upon the Windows launch, sometimes during the greeting screen, sometimes a half minute after desktop loads;
    5) less often BSOD occurs while im gaming or when PC is simply idling, those BSODs seem completely random and unrelated to the current load on the system but I might be wrong;
    6) PC is clean from dust and it doesnt seem to be the heat issue, since BSOD often occurs on low temperatures;
    7) Sometimes there are several days between BSODs and sometimes it happens 2 or 3 times in a row upon the system start as described in point 4).
